New Yorker Festival Pairs Off Literati

We’re getting the first drabs and drips of information about October’s upcoming New Yorker festival, the magazine’s three-day weekend of cultural symposia, concerts, and other events. Here’s what we can tell you about the literary side of things: In addition to the usual Friday night readings, there’s also going to be a set of events that feature “authors in conversation.” Among the couplings: Miranda July and AM Homes will discuss deviants, Sir Salman Rushdie and Orhan Pamuk trade insights on homeland, and Martin Amis and Norman Mailer will talk about “monsters,” although I wouldn’t be surprised if that turns into a discussion of totalitarian leaders like Stalin and Hitler, about whom they’ve each respectively written.
